Healthcare stocks were rising premarket Thursday, with the State Street Health Care Select Sector SPDR ETF (XLV) 1.5% higher and the iShares Biotechnology ETF (IBB) advancing by 0.6%.
Biogen (BIIB) shares were up more than 1% after the company said the US Food and Drug Administration has granted breakthrough therapy designation for Salanersen to treat spinal muscular atrophy, a rare, genetic and neuromuscular disease.
Royal Philips (PHG) and WellSpan Health said they have entered into a seven-year partnership focused on research, innovation, and the deployment of advanced imaging and diagnostic technologies across WellSpan's network. Shares of Royal Philips were up more than 1% pre-bell.
Amneal Pharmaceuticals (AMRX) stock was 1% higher after the company said has received the US Food and Drug Administration's approval for its romidepsin injection solution.
